Venezuela Will Not Request Arms Supplies From Russia - Foreign Minister

VIENNA (UrduPoint News / Sputnik - 15th March, 2019) Venezuela has a well-established defense cooperation with Russia, so there is no need to request arms supplies from Moscow, Venezuelan Foreign Minister Jorge Arreaza told Sputnik Friday.
"We have a very good defense cooperation with Russia and will maintain it that way.
The major part of our military equipment is from Russia, but currently there is no need [to ask for new arms]," the minister said.
Answering the question when the planned transfer of the PDVSA office from Lisbon to Moscow will take place, the minister said "as soon as possible."
